| Amelie Mauresmo Retires |
| French tennis great Amelie Mauresmo is officially hanging up the racquets. The two-time Grand Slam champion and former No. 1 made the announcement today at a press conference in France.

| Singles Stars Kuznetsova, Mauresmo Top Doubles Specialists in Miami Final |
| Singles beat doubles in the doubles final at the Sony Ericsson Open in Miami when wildcard entrants and singles stars Svetlana Kuznetsova and Amelie Mauresmo defeated doubles specialists and No. 3 seeds Kveta Peschke and Lisa Raymond 4-6, 6-3, 10-3 for the title.
